FAQ

Which has the higher dividend yield, STOT or VOO?

STOT currently has the higher trailing yield: STOT yields 4.42% and VOO yields 1.04%. Yield changes daily with price, so check the live figures above.

How often do STOT and VOO pay?

STOT pays every month and VOO pays every quarter. STOT's next ex-date is Oct 1, 2026 and VOO's is Sep 25, 2026.

Which has grown its dividend faster, STOT or VOO?

STOT has grown its payout faster: 24.5%/yr vs 6.8%/yr over the last 5 years.
